Job Title: Hotel Revenue Manager

Job Summary:
The Hotel Revenue Manager is responsible for maximizing revenue and profit for the hotel by developing and implementing effective pricing and inventory strategies. This role involves analyzing market trends, monitoring competitor pricing, and collaborating with various departments to ensure optimal revenue performance.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Revenue Optimization:
  • Develop and implement pricing strategies to optimize revenue across all room categories and other revenue streams.
  • Monitor market trends, competitor pricing, and demand to adjust strategies accordingly.
  • Utilize revenue management systems and tools to analyze data and make informed decisions.
  • Inventory Management:
  • Manage room inventory to maximize revenue and occupancy.
  • Implement overbooking and inventory control strategies to minimize revenue loss.
  • Monitor and adjust room allocations based on demand patterns.
  • Distribution Channel Management:
  • Collaborate with online travel agencies (OTAs), Global Distribution Systems (GDS), and other distribution partners to optimize visibility and revenue.
  • Negotiate contracts and agreements with distribution partners to ensure favorable terms for the hotel.
  • Forecasting and Reporting:
  • Develop and maintain accurate revenue forecasts based on historical data and market trends.
  • Generate regular reports for management, highlighting key performance indicators and areas for improvement.
  • Collaboration with Departments:
  • Work closely with the sales, marketing, and reservations teams to align strategies and achieve overall business goals.
  • Provide training and guidance to hotel staff on revenue management principles.
  • Data Analysis:
  • Conduct thorough analysis of data related to room revenue, booking patterns, and market trends.
  • Use data-driven insights to make strategic decisions and recommendations.
  • Technology Utilization:
  • Stay updated on industry trends and advancements in revenue management technology.
  • Evaluate and implement new tools and systems to enhance revenue management processes.

Qualifications and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Hospitality Management, Business, or a related field.
  • Proven experience in hotel revenue management or related roles.
  • Strong analytical and mathematical skills.
  • Familiarity with revenue management software and tools.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ams.
